Action item from the Mirewater tide-table widget incident. Owner: release manager. Widget cached stale harbor offsets after the DST change, showing tides six hours off for two days. Required: add a cache-invalidation check to the release checklist, block deploys when offset tables are older than 24 hours, and verify the Saltgate harbor feed before each cut. Deadline: next release. Checklist template and sign-off procedure are documented on the internal page below.

wiki page, kawif-bajep: https://artifactory.zarqelforge.internal/issue/browse/display/display/projects/spaces/secrets/000fe6ec5a46af29355003e1

Re: vendoring the Glyphstead font family — agreed we should pin exact files rather than pull from the foundry mirror at build time; their CDN has broken us twice. I'd keep only the two weights we actually render and subset to Latin plus the currency glyphs, which cuts payload by ~70%. Please add a checksum verification step in the fetch script so future updates are deliberate. For reviewers bumping versions later, the subset and cache parameters are as follows.

tuning table, kahop-fahog:
RATE_LIMITS = {
    "wenix": 1,
    "druael": 10,
    "holix": 1,
    "zorael": 1,
}

- [ ] **Step 7: Breaker override escrow.** After sealing the signing keys for the Tallgrove upstream API circuit breaker, confirm the support team can force the breaker open during a full outage. The override bundle lives in the sealed escrow drawer and is useless without its unlock phrase. Two ceremony witnesses must initial this step before proceeding. The escrow bundle is decrypted with the recovery passphrase that follows.

vault phrase of kahip-kahop = holath-quenmir

When customers report that exported reports show times off by several hours, the cause is almost always the workspace timezone setting in Quartermill, not a bug. Exports render timestamps in the workspace default, while the dashboard renders in the viewer's browser timezone. Ask the customer which timezone their workspace is set to before escalating. If the offsets still do not match after accounting for DST transitions, open a ticket with the Exports squad. The step-by-step verification checklist lives on the internal page below.

dashboard of tawef-hagug = https://superset.norvadyn.local/display/projects/build/ticket/build/spaces/ticket/1e989f0e6c200d20fc4ae06b